    Custom Clearing Officer

    George Houston Resources (GHR) is currently seeking to recruit experienced Custom Clearing Officers in two locations across Lagos State for her client, an international Trading company.  

    Locations : Victoria Island & Amuwo Odofin,  Lagos

     RESPONSIBILITIES

    •  Practical and Hands on experience in the process of establishing Mform, Letters of credit, SON (Standard Organization Of Nigeria) 
    • Online Applications, shipping documents and other related import clearing operations
    • Identifying items and containers of incoming and outgoing shipments and verifying them against consignment records
    • Ensuring outgoing shipments are in good condition and meet specifications
    • Arranging internal distribution of goods received organizing the dispatch of goods with completed documentation
    • Maintaining prescribed records of goods received and dispatched
    • Examining shipping documents and verifying cargo to be released
    • Recording customs clearance requirements and authorizing collection of cargo
    • Calculating storage and clearance charges and billing customers
    • Receiving details of outgoing cargo, and arranging bookings of freight space and collection of goods from customers
    • Providing information to customers on custom tariffs, tariff classifications and concessions, and methods of clearing goods

     QUALIFICATION 

    • HND/BSc  in any relevant field 
    • 3-4 years relevant experience in a multi-national company. 
    •  Communication and Computer skills (Excel and Words) are highly essential. 
    • Exposure to NAVISION software is an added advantage

    Supply Chain Officer

    George Houston Resources (GHR) is currently seeking to recruit experienced Senior Supply Chain Officer for her Client, a leading Manufacturing and international Trading conglomerate in Nigeria.

    Job Description
    Roles and Responsibilities 

    • Follow the MRP to generate the forecast for suppliers required, and obtain confirmation from suppliers
    • Prepare and release Purchase Orders IPO/Form M/LC on time as per the planned orders generated by the ERP
    • Update Purchase Orders in regards to quantity, confirmation date, ship date, and delivery date.
    • Request pending deliveries from suppliers and correct P.O. accordingly
    • Escalation at the right time, conduct meetings with Suppliers, cross-functional teams to address the issues
    • Solve all discrepancies on invoices due to prices and non-expected extra costs
    • Coordinate all general mailing actions to be taken related to supplier issues
    • Coordinate with Logistics for freight forwarding & customs clearance
    • Update the supply matrix (lead time, delivery times, MOQ, minimum and maximum lots, etc.)
    • Daily review of shortages & Overstocks
    • -To maintain the Inventory target set by the organization
    • Knowledge of Advance license, SON & customs process
    • Work cross-functionally with sales and branch managers to drive cost, delivery, quality, and supplier development.
    • Manage relationships with suppliers for purchase order execution
    • Manage problems and schedules changes
    • Actively participate in supplier performance review.

     Basic Qualifications 

    • HND/BSC and a minimum of 6 years experience in Sourcing and Supply chain) 
    • A minimum of 3 years experience in Manufacturing, Quality, Materials, Sourcing or Supply Chain Operations.

     Desired Characteristics 

    • Strong background in contract execution    
    • Experience in a Buyer role in trading or related industry
    • Manufacturing or Shop Operations experience 
    • Ability to analyze data and perform pricing analysis
    • Experience with sourcing of new suppliers / vendors
    • Ability to utilize Excel for data analysis
    • Strong interpersonal and leadership skills
    • Ability to influence others and lead small teams
    • Effective problem identification and solution skills
    • Ability to document, plan, market, and execute program

    Finance Executive

    Our client, a leading manufacturing company is seeking to recruit suitably qualified Finance Executives to join their Accounting Team.

    Location: Amuwo, Mile 2 - Lagos
     Job Summary 

    Oversees accounting functions, including general ledger, cash receipts, accounts receivable, accounts payable, petty cash, and bank reconciliation 

     Essential Duties & Responsibilities 

    • Oversees accounting functions, including general ledger, cash receipts, accounts receivable, accounts payable, petty cash, and bank reconciliation 
    • Ensure financial management and adequate financial controls.
    • Maintains adequate records of all transactions and ensures that transactions are posted daily / weekly (i.e. local banking transactions, receipts, cheque payments, petty cash transactions, etc).
    • Conducts monthly bank reconciliation.
    • Prepares the monthly Staff payroll and coordinates such matters with the Finance Manager.
    • Responsible for the statutory deductions of PAYE Tax, Pension, Withholding Tax and VAT, and remittance to the relevant local authorities on a monthly basis.
    • Prepares a schedule of monthly fee notes and clients’ payment status.
    • Maintains records of staff travel advances and compilation of un-retired advances at the end of each month.
    • Performs cash management functions. Ensures Client accounts are properly funded.
    • Uses and is familiar with the company’s financial computer systems, manuals and procedures. 
    • Maintains and updates procedural manual as needed. 
    • Any other responsibility assigned by line manager.

     Qualification & Other Attributes 

    • HND/BSC in Accounting, Chartered is a plus 
    • Minimum of 4 years core accounting in Manufacturing sector 
    • Ability to work without supervision.
    • Organizational skills with attention to detail.
    • Reporting skills, deadline-oriented, time management.
    • Reasoning ability, mathematical ability, and logical thinking skills.
    • Problem solving and Effective time-management skills.
    • Proficient with MS Office (word, excel, Power point) 
    • MUST have knowledge of any accounting software usage such as Peachtree, Sage, SAP, Tally etc.
    • Excellent interpersonal and written communication skills.
